The term precision refers to which description? in algebra i

Answer:

Precision refers to the closeness of two or more measurements to each other. Using the example above, if you weigh a given substance five times, and get 3.2 kg each time, then your measurement is very precise.

Step-by-step explanation:

Precision is independent of accuracy. You can be very precise but inaccurate, as described above. hope this helps you :)
